Detroit Demolition vs. Keith Steinborn (10/2/88)

 

Squash.

 

Next we get a promo by Dr. Tom regarding him winning the King of Birmingham tourney.

 

Willie B. Hert vs. "Nightmare" Ken Wayne (10/2/88)

 

There was some good back and forth action here with Wayne bumping hard for Willie and trying to attack his head which wasn't the right move since you know he's black and has a hard head. The action would eventually go to the floor where both men got counted out. Decent for what it was.

 

Grappler #2 vs. Lee Peak (10/2/88)

 

Peak actually gets some offense in here before losing.

 

"Universal Heartthrob" Austin Idol vs. Private Pyle (10/2/88)

 

Pyle would use a foreign object to neutralize Idol but not for long as Idol comes back and squashes Pyle.

 

Next we get promos from DWB & Jerry Stubbs who is a heel again.

 

"Dirty White Boy" Tony Anthony & "Mr. Perfect" Jerry Stubbs vs. The Party Patrol (Davey & Johnny Rich) (10/2/88)

 

Rich's look strong early working over the heels with timely double-team moves being key in their offense. They were throwing some really good punches as well and the heels were solid at selling the punishment. The heels would use double-team moves as well to gain the advantage and took proper short cuts to get the advantage on Johnny. DWB & Stubbs were a very good team and had nice chemistry here knowing how to work as a team to keep Johnny isolated in the ring. Davey would finally get the hot tag and the 4-way brawl was on until DWB clubbed Davey with a foreign object allowing Stubbs to get the pin. The heels keep going afterwards until The Bullet runs out to clean house. Fun TV match and I think it's worthy of another look as a low-end pick.

 

Then we get promos from DWB & Stubbs from the locker room about Bullet's attack.

 

"White Lightning" Tim Horner vs. Mr. Alan Martin (10/2/88)

 

Kokina is still with Martin at ringside and gets his potshots in on Horner. Kokina's presence would backfire though as Horner threw Martin into him and got the O'Connor Roll to win.
